Book Overview

Coming Home To Roost V3: A Novel is a work of fiction written by the author Gerald Grant. The book is the third installment in the Coming Home To Roost series and tells the story of a family's journey through life in rural America. The novel is set in the small town of Roost, where the protagonist, Jake, returns after many years of living in the city. Jake is a successful businessman who has built a life for himself in the city, but he feels a strong pull back to his roots in Roost. As he settles back into life in the town, Jake reconnects with old friends and family members, including his estranged father. He also becomes involved in the local politics of the town, which is facing a number of challenges, including economic decline and social unrest. Throughout the novel, Grant explores themes of family, community, and the struggles of rural America. He delves into the complexities of small-town life, where everyone knows each other's business and the past is never truly forgotten.
